Long a Betty White fan, host Cynthia Bemis Abrams reviews the career and actions of the accomplished comedian and actor, Betty White. Working from Betty's own memoirs, Cynthia recounts how Betty was bitten by the acting bug and her early roles. Highlighting "Life With Elizabeth," one of the earliest titled female in a comedy (1953-55), Cynthia observes the early hits of the eventual SueAnn Nivens.
